>> Are there any empty nodes that make sense, or is a empty always node
>> nonsense?
>
> I'd say the validators are right, because a node that is neither part of a
> way, nor part of a relation, and has no tags is simply useless: we have no
> idea why it sits there.
+1, at least if they are older than some days/weeks. If someone is
doing a very big upload it might be (dependant on the way he
structures the upload) that he is first uploading nodes and only later
the ways. That's why I wouldn't delete recently created empty nodes.
